Trump says he will solve Afghanistan-Pakistan crisis 'very quickly' as peace talks enter second day
Summary
U.S. President Donald Trump said he will solve the Afghanistan-Pakistan crisis very quickly as peace talks between the two countries enter their second day in Istanbul.
Key Points
- U.S. President Donald Trump promised to solve the Afghanistan-Pakistan crisis very quickly amid ongoing peace talks.
- The conflict involves mutual accusations of aggression and militant cross-border attacks between Afghanistan and Pakistan.
- Peace talks in Istanbul aim to transform a fragile ceasefire into a durable peace and border security framework.
- Afghan and Pakistani sides exchanged drafts focusing on ceasefire monitoring and preventing anti-Afghan groups from operating on Pakistani territory.
